Solution for -8-4x=-16-6x equation:



-8-4x=-16-6x
We move all terms to the left:
-8-4x-(-16-6x)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-4x-(-6x-16)-8=0
We get rid of parentheses
-4x+6x+16-8=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
2x+8=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
2x=-8
x=-8/2
x=-4
